We have recently learned that both the House Judiciary and House Intelligence Committees will mark up USA PATRIOT Act reauthorization legislation this week.  A floor vote in the House is expected the week of July 18th.  Now is the time to tell your representative to protect civil liberties! 

 

Some proponents of the PATRIOT Act are already pointing to the terrorist attacks in London as further justification for suspending the protections guaranteed by the Bill of Rights.  While we all abhor these acts of terror, neither the recent attacks nor the September 11, 2001, attacks render our Bill of Rights obsolete.  Please call, email, and fax your House member as often as possible this week to express your concern about threats to civil liberties (see our talking points below).  If your representative voted in favor of Rep. Bernie Sanders' Freedom to Read Amendment to the SSJC Appropriations bill (see vote results at http://clerk.house.gov/evs/2005/roll258.xml), or is a co-sponsor of any liberty-restoring bills (see below), please thank him or her.

Talking Points

 

Urge your representative to:

  • restore personal privacy;
  • restore due process;
  • respect First Amendment rights to assemble and to petition (criticize) the government;
  • limit the definition of "terrorism" to violent crimes perpetrated on human civilian targets for political gain;
  • prohibit all authorized prisoner abuse;
  • restore respect for the rule of law;
  • decrease government secrecy; and
  • respect the balance of power between the branches of government.
